WebHurricane Katrina was the largest and 3rd strongest hurricane ever recorded to make landfall in the US. [1] In New Orleans, the levees were designed for Category 3, but Katrina peaked at a Category 5 hurricane, with winds up to 175 mph. [2] The final death toll was at 1,836, primarily from Louisiana (1,577) and Mississippi (238). WebNov 25, 2024 · An interesting fact is that Hurricane Katrina remains the costliest hurricane in U.S. history, causing an estimated $161 billion in damage along the U.S. Gulf Coast. It destroyed or damaged more than 850,000 homes. Between 300,000 to 350,000 vehicles were also destroyed, as well as 2,400 ships and vessels.
